Date : FEB 2 1994
From : Deputy Assistant Secretary for Health Management Operations
Subject : Delegation of Authority to Determine When Term Appointments
are Appropriate
To: PHS Agency Heads
Authorities Deleaated and to Whom
1. Pursuant to the authority delegated by the Assistant
Secretary for Personnel Administration (ASPER) to the
Assistant Secretary for Health on September 29, 1993,
and the January 14, 1991, Delegation of Personnel
Administration and Personnel Management Authoities from
the Acting Assistant Secretary for Health,to the Deputy
Assistant Secretary for Health Management Operations,
PHS, I hereby delegate to.the PHS agency heads, for
positions within their respective agencies,Excluding
positions in or under the regional offices the
authority to determine that a position or positions may
be filled by term appointments.
Redelegation and Restrictions
2. This authority is limited to the determination that a
position or positions may be filled by term
appointments. The actual filling of the positions for
which term appointments are authorized must still be
done under competitive procedures.
3. This authority may be redelegated to the PHS agency
personnel officers with further redelegation authorized.
Information and Guidance
4. Requirements and instructions for exercising this
authority are contained in Federal Personnel Manual
Chapter 316.
Prior Delegations
5. This delegation supersedes the March 12, 1981,
Delegation of Authority to Determine When Term
Appointments are Appropriate from the Acting Director,
Office of Management, PHS, to the PHS Agency Heads. To
the extent that previous redelegations of this authority:
are consistent with the provisions of this delegation they
remain in effect.
Effective Date
6. This delegation is effective upon date of signature.
